Color accuracy is critical in photography, and the Godox AD400Pro delivers with a stable color temperature that changes within ±75K over the entire power range. This consistency is crucial for maintaining the integrity of my images, especially when working in varied lighting conditions. Furthermore, the two power supply methods provide me with flexibility. The large capacity 21.6V/2600mAh lithium battery pack allows for 390 full-power flashes and quick recycling, while the option to use the Godox AD-AC Power Source Adapter means I can easily switch between AC and DC power sources as needed.
Portability is another significant advantage of the Godox AD400Pro. Weighing in at just 2.1Kg and measuring 220102128 mm (without the flash tube and reflector), this flash is easy to transport. One of the standout features of the Godox AD400Pro is its large capacity rechargeable battery. With a GN of 72 and the ability to deliver 380 full-power flashes, I can confidently shoot for extended periods without worrying about running out of power. The recycling time of just 0.01 to 0.9 seconds ensures that I won’t miss those fleeting moments, which is crucial for capturing action shots or spontaneous events. Having the option to adjust the power in nine steps from 1/128 to 1/1, along with flash durations as short as 1/12,240 seconds, offers remarkable control over my lighting setup.
Moreover, the AD400Pro fully supports TTL (Through The Lens) functionality, which simplifies the shooting process by automatically adjusting the flash output based on the camera settings. This feature allows me to focus more on composition and less on technical adjustments, especially in dynamic environments. The high-speed sync capability of up to 1/8000 seconds is another game-changer, enabling me to shoot wide open in bright conditions while freezing motion with precision.
